But today, I had something else on my mind. No one ever touches on the issue of those who play… the Race Card. For those unfamiliar with that term, Race Card is a metaphorical reference to a Trump Card, which is used to gain advantages in card games. The race card is the act of bringing race or racism into a debate-oftentimes being used to negate the real issue at hand.

            Many people say the biggest example of The Race Card came in the form of the O.J Simpson trial. Critics say that O.J’s defense team played the race card to help him avoid conviction for murder. They brought up Mark Furman’s racist past and informed the jury that he was once caught on police surveillance using the word “nigger.” His past accusations of tampering with murder evidence in prior cases also came into play. In the end, O.J was found Not Guilty- but his public displays of stupidity that resulted in the following years left many to wonder if he in fact was guilty and saved by the Race Card.
